During the medieval period, which group played an important role in staging plays in various parts of towns? landholders shop owners peasants trade guilds

During the medieval period, Trade guilds played an important role in staging plays in various parts of towns. Trade guilds were important because they built the props and production.

The guilds were an important part of city and town life. Guilds were ;

  • exclusive, regimented organizations;
  • created in part to preserve the rights and privileges of their members; and
  • separate and distinct from the civic governments, but since the functions and purposes of guild and civic government overlapped, it was not always easy to tell them apart, especially since many well-to-do guildsmen were prominent in civic government.
